**Product Introduction: Nichrome V Fittings / UNS N06003**
**Overview**
Nichrome V Fittings (UNS N06003) are precision-engineered components manufactured from nickel-chromium alloy, specifically designed for high-temperature applications requiring excellent oxidation resistance and reliable performance. These fittings maintain the superior electrical and thermal properties of Nichrome V while providing secure connections in heating systems and high-temperature industrial equipment.
**Key Characteristics**
- Excellent oxidation resistance up to 1150°C
- High temperature strength and stability
- Good creep resistance at elevated temperatures
- Superior corrosion resistance
- Excellent thermal shock resistance
- Good weldability and machinability

**Chemical Composition (Weight %)**
| Element | Content (%) |
|------------------|-----------------|
| Nickel (Ni) | 78.0 - 80.0 |
| Chromium (Cr) | 19.0 - 21.0 |
| Iron (Fe) | ≤ 1.0 |
| Silicon (Si) | ≤ 1.0 |
| Manganese (Mn) | ≤ 1.0 |
| Carbon (C) | ≤ 0.15 |
| Sulfur (S) | ≤ 0.015 |
---
**Physical Properties**
| Property | Value |
|-------------------------------|---------------------------|
| Density | 8.40 g/cm³ (0.303 lb/in³) |
| Melting Range | 1400-1420°C (2552-2588°F) |
| Electrical Resistivity | 1.09 μΩ·m |
| Thermal Conductivity | 13.0 W/m·K |
| Specific Heat Capacity | 450 J/kg·K |
| Mean Coefficient of Thermal Expansion | 13.0 × 10⁻⁶/°C |
| Modulus of Elasticity | 210 GPa (30.5 × 10⁶ psi) |
---
**Mechanical Properties (Annealed Condition)**
| Temperature | Tensile Strength | Yield Strength (0.2%) | Elongation |
|------------------|------------------|----------------------|------------|
| Room Temperature | 860-965 MPa | 480-550 MPa | 25-35% |
| 800°C (1472°F) | 240-310 MPa | 170-210 MPa | 35-45% |
| 1000°C (1832°F) | 110-140 MPa | 80-110 MPa | 40-50% |

**Installation & Maintenance**
**Welding Recommendations**
- TIG welding recommended
- Use matching filler metal
- Proper purging with inert gas
- Post-weld heat treatment if required
**Service Limitations**
- Maximum continuous service temperature: 1150°C
- Not recommended for sulfur-rich atmospheres above 800°C
- Avoid rapid thermal cycling when possible
